Kinks' Dave Davies To Hit The Road

(10/2/98, 12 p.m. PDT) - Dave Davies, the legendary founder and lead guitarist for the seminal rock band the Kinks, is currently touring the West Coast to promote his new CD Unfinished Business, a limited-edition release available only at the shows or on Dave Davies' official website, www.davedavies.com. Davies will be backed by a four-piece Los Angeles-based band.

"I'll be trying out songs I haven't performed before, some newly-written songs, and some of the Kinks standards," Davies recently said of the tour. His setlists on previous solo tours have included Kinks such classics as "All Day And All Of the Night" and "I Need You," as well as rarely-heard gems like "Creepin' Jean" and "Young And Innocent Days."

In related Dave Davies news, on Feb. 23 of next year Velvel Records will release a Dave Davies two-disc anthology containing many of his and the Kinks' greatest songs recorded over the last 35 years. The European version, released by Castle Communications, will contain unreleased and rare tracks, including a demo by the Ravens (the original name of the Kinks), and a number of songs off of Davies' album, Chosen People, which has never been released on CD.

Velvel is currently in the middle of a Kinks reissue campaign; so far, the label has re-released 1971's Muswell Hillbillies, 1972's Everybody's In Showbiz, 1973's Preservation Act 1 and 1974's Preservation Act 2.
